Phillies Promote CF Johan Rojas to the Show
Late last night, rumors started to swirl regarding a Johan Rojas promotion to the big club. Finally, a few minutes ago, one of the beat writers confirmed the move (Gelb) on Twitter.
It was also reported that Rojas will fill Cristian Pache’s role on the team. Pache is expected to be placed on the 60-man IL as the partnering move.
In other news, it was also hinted that another promotion is expected (Drew Ellis) to replace the injured Josh Harrison who went on the 10-day IL yesterday.
